Description
This book aims to provide a broad and accessible overview of the institutions, processes, and actors that define and determine public policies in Singapore. Through the application of cutting-edge public policy theories and the use of case studies, this book will provide both academic and general readers with a comprehensive overview of Singapore's public policy processes and how these have contributed to the city-state's policy successes. In doing so, this book aims to provide a systematic understanding of public policy in Singapore that is accessible to a wide range of readers.
